Would you like to get a start making puppets or other crafty things, but don't quite have a grasp on sewing by hand? Good news! This sewing for beginners workshop is perfect for you!
Description:
You'll learn 4-6 of different hand-stitches, & of course you'll get to practice them. We'll get through as many stitches as we can in our 2 hours. You'll even learn a couple of tricks for threading needles & tying knots. Learn the basics of marionette construction, from building to stringing! Participants will construct and customize a human marionette and learn how to string the puppet with an airplane controller.
Description:
Learn the basics of marionette construction, from building to stringing! Suitable for beginners wanting to learn more about marionettes; participants will construct and customize a simple 9-string human marionette from card and foam. This workshop will cover building and properly weighting an 18-inch figure, and simple stringing with a basic airplane controller. Participants will leave with instructions and patterns to build additional puppets, as well as resources for building more complex puppets and performance tips.
